Chassis mods and bump steer whats best.

Hello everyone. I am a newbie here and also new to the 55-59 truck world. I posted a while back that I had purchased a 59 big window p/u cab and related parts. Last week I dragged home a 55 pickup with a pretty clean original frame. I have searched and read many posts and build threads. Actually, I have read so much that I am thoroughly confused. My goal is to have a truck that stops well, steers well, has no bump steer, and rides okay. Power steering is a must as other family members may be driving it. Bump steer is also a huge concern to me. I did not want to go Mustang 2 or Camaro clip. I had decided on a Crown Vic front end but then read they are a little wider and wheel choice would be limited, but I'm still pondering that. The other thought I have is to leave the straight axle and get a CCP power steering kit that leaves the box behind the axle. I would add disc brakes up front and swap out the rear end 5 lug all around. If I went that route how do I correct for bump steer? Has anyone ever done a cross steer with this box? Would it have bad bump steer if not? I think someone mentioned a longer front spring also for a softer ride. I only want to do this once and plan on doing as much myself as possible. If I went the Crown Vic route, which I would rather not, I would probably start with a salvage yard unit and go from there. I think I have enough previous fabrication skills to adapt it nicely.
